Obituary: Patricia Jane Rowe, age 79, of Rapid City, Michigan and St. James City, Florida passed away suddenly on April 20th, 2025.
Born on January 11, 1946 in Jackson, Michigan to the late Dr. Ronald and Phyllis (Tuohy) Waldby; Pat was raised in Traverse City, and was a 1964 graduate of Traverse City Central High School.
Pat was a champion for the down-trodden, lonely, and afflicted. She was deeply compassionate for the underdog and was generous in support of people in need.
She enjoyed collecting and (at times) selling antiques and loved 1950s DooWop music. A lifelong Detroit Tiger fan, Pat cheered wildly for her team and favorite players from Harvey Kueen to Max Scherzer.
Combining her love of baseball and her sewing skills, Pat labored for two years to create a baseball quilt with over 60 hand-sewn baseball card panels plus other hand embroidered items. Upon completion, the quilt was put on public display at the Traverse City library.
